Car you believe it?

We like that this Hyundai x Amazon commercial about sentient toys and SUVs that fly through the air has to say 'Dramatization' at the bottom of the screen. Is it to ensure no one who goes on an Amazon fulfilment centre tour demands a refund afterwards? Maybe this is how you avoid complaints like: "I paid to see a monkey ride a tricycle!"

Whatever level of reality you want to operate on, directors Los Pérez (Tania Verduzco and Adrián Pérez) deliver a super piece of work set in a warehouse full of common-or-garden Amazon purchases, including suitcases, remote control cars, drones, and Army men. As they all make a beeline for the front door, the largest crate in the depot opens up.

Out pops a Hyundai 2025 Sante Fe SUV, now available to buy on the advertised website and collect at a local dealer. A plastic paratrooper manages to land on the roof, only to get wiped out by a window crawler toy. A close-up of his inscrutable face before impact is a lovely touch.

The ad then cuts to the buyer in bed with his wife and children fast asleep next to him. We hope they discussed this monumental purchase before bedtime!
